Specifications include, but are not limited to: The school physician shall provide, at a minimum, the following services: 1. Consultation in the development and implementation of school district policies, procedures and mechanisms related to health, safety and medical emergencies pursuant to N.J.A.C. 6A:16-2.l(a); 2. Consultation to school district medical staff regarding the delivery of school health services, which includes special health care needs of technology- supported and medically fragile children, including students covered by 20 U.S.C. § 1400 et. seq., Individuals with Disabilities Education Act; 3. Physical examinations conducted in the school physician's office or other comparably equipped facility for students who do not have a medical home or whose parent has identified the school as the medical home for the purpose of the sports physical examination; 4. Provision of written notification to the parent stating approval or disapproval of the student's participation in athletics based upon the medical report; 5. Direction for professional duties of other medical staff; 6. Written standing orders that shall be reviewed and reissued before the beginning of each school year; 7. Establishment of standards of care for emergency situations and medically related care involving students and school staff;
